Finance Minister Inaugurates BITS Campus in Mumbai : A Beacon of Innovation and Sustainability
![BITS-Mumbai](https://sp-ao.shortpixel.ai/client/to_webp,q_glossy,ret_img,w_1275,h_718/https://www.bits-pilani.ac.in/wp-content/uploads/BITS-Mumbai.jpg)
We are delighted to announce that Finance Minister Smt Nirmala Sitharaman inaugurated our fifth campus in the Mumbai Metropolitan Region (near Kalyan) on 24 Feb 2024 in the presence of our Chancellor, Mr Kumar Mangalam Birla. This campus will house our BITS School of Management (BITSoM), BITS Law School (BITSLAW), and BITS Design School (BITSDES). It is a digital-first campus, with a Centre of Excellence and an Academic Building collectively housing the library, a startup incubation center, classrooms equipped for hybrid teaching, an event hall, video and podcast studios, tutorial rooms, and trans-disciplinary learning and collaboration spaces. The campus is fully residential and can accommodate 5000 students when fully developed. It also has sports facilities, a gymnasium, and a cafeteria. Spread across 63 acres, 80% of the space is dedicated to lush green landscaping. The campus has a zero-discharge scheme with 100% recycled water utilization, energy-saving lighting systems, and solar power with a vision towards a zero-carbon footprint.
